Go Quietly

Neither of us will go quietly.
That was obvious from the first.
Her moans and denials and fight are only restrained by the liquid morphine that courses through her veins.
She will not go quietly.
On the way to see her.
On the way to see her for the last time.
I did not go quietly.
The sounds of the engine and the radio could not be heard over my shrieks and sobs.
When the end comes
neither of us will go quietly
even if we don’t make a sound.
